In their origins, coats of arms were awarded individually, not as symbols of an entire family, and were associated with the person who had received them for their achievements, exploits in battle or social position. Over time, the Erzen coat of arms became hereditary, becoming a recognizable emblem of family heritage, thus establishing a lasting connection with the Erzen surname.
Transmission: Although the coat of arms may be associated with Erzen, it is essential to keep in mind that they were traditionally granted to individuals. This implies that not all individuals with the surname Erzen can claim heraldic right to the shield related to Erzen, especially if they cannot prove direct ancestry to the original holder of the shield. Likewise, it is possible to find different shields associated with the surname Erzen, since they could have been granted to people from different families but with the surname Erzen.
Variations: Within a family with the surname Erzen, it is common to find different variants of the heraldic blazon that serve to distinguish between different family branches, generations or even individual titles.
